Dry bulk shipping refers to the transportation of unpackaged bulk commodities such as coal, iron ore, grain, and fertilizers using specialized vessels designed to carry large amounts of dry cargo across global trade routes. These goods are transported in solid, dry form and are typically loaded directly into the ship's cargo hold without the need for containers.

The primary types of dry bulk shipping vessels include capesize, panamax, supramax, and handysize. Capesize vessels are large bulk carriers that exceed 150,000 deadweight tons (DWT) and are too large to pass through the Panama Canal. These ships come in various designs, such as gearless bulk carriers, conventional bulkers, combined bulk carriers, self-dischargers, and bulker lakers. Their main applications involve transporting materials such as iron ore, coal, grains, bauxite or alumina, and phosphate rock.

The dry bulk shipping market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$11.36 billion in 2024 to $12.16 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.0%. The growth during the historic period can be attributed to the increased demand for raw materials, a rise in infrastructure development, growth in seaborne trade, expansion in steel production, and the increased use of LNG-powered vessels.

The dry bulk shipping market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$15.79 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.8%. The growth during the forecast period can be attributed to the rising demand for energy resources, a surge in the demand for clean energy, increased investment in port infrastructure, and a growing focus on sustainable practices. Key trends expected during this period include advancements in shipping methods, digitalization in the shipping industry, the adoption of eco-friendly technologies, increased automation in shipping, and the use of digital tracking and data analytics.

The growing demand for coal is expected to drive the growth of the dry bulk shipping market in the future. Coal is a combustible sedimentary rock made from ancient plant matter, primarily consisting of carbon, and is a key energy source for electricity generation and industrial processes. The rise in demand for coal is driven by increasing energy needs, industrial expansion, and continued reliance on coal-fired power plants in various regions. Dry bulk shipping plays a crucial role in transporting coal, offering an efficient, cost-effective, and large-scale method of moving these heavy, high-volume commodities across global trade routes. This helps ensure a steady supply to industries and power plants while supporting infrastructure and economic growth worldwide. For example, in February 2025, the U.S. Energy Information Administration (EIA) reported a 5.9% increase in coal exports in the U.S. for the third quarter of 2024 compared to the second quarter. Additionally, U.S. coal production in the third quarter of 2024 reached 136.2 million short tons, up by 15.3% from the previous quarter. Thus, the rising demand for coal is driving the growth of the dry bulk shipping market.

Companies in the dry bulk shipping market are working on innovations such as the dry bulk composite index to enhance transparency, improve freight pricing efficiency, and optimize operational strategies through data-driven decisions. The Dry Bulk Composite Index serves as a benchmark that tracks and measures freight rate trends in the dry bulk shipping market, reflecting the costs of transporting major bulk commodities such as coal, iron ore, and grain. For example, in November 2023, Platts, part of S&P Global Commodity Insights, launched the Platts Dry Index (PDI), a comprehensive benchmark for the dry bulk shipping market, priced in dollars per day. This is the first such index in over thirty years to be priced in dollars per day, reflecting freight costs across 35 major routes used by capesize, panamax/kamsarmax, ultramax, and supramax vessels. The index combines weighted average time charter equivalent indices from various vessel segments, with the weights based on trade flow volumes observed over three years using Platts' Commodities At Sea system.

In April 2024, Star Bulk Carriers Corp., a shipping company based in Greece, acquired Eagle Bulk Shipping Inc. for $2.1 billion. This acquisition aims to strengthen Star Bulk Carriers' position in the dry bulk shipping sector by expanding its fleet capacity, enhancing operational efficiency, and leveraging Eagle Bulk Shipping's established expertise in transporting dry bulk cargo to meet the growing global demand for commodities. Eagle Bulk Shipping Inc. is a U.S.-based company that specializes in transporting bulk commodities such as coal, grain, iron ore, and fertilizers.
